How It Works

This calculator converts a frame count to its equivalent timecode value (HH:MM:SS:FF) based on your project's frame rate. Perfect for determining timecode positions from frame numbers in professional editing workflows.

1

Input Frame Count

Enter the frame count you want to convert and select your project's frame rate

2

Apply Frame Rate Math

Calculate hours, minutes, seconds, and remaining frames using frame rate division

3

Format as Timecode

Convert the calculated values into professional HH:MM:SS:FF or drop frame format

4

Use in Editing

Apply the timecode position for precise cuts, sync points, and frame-accurate editing

Calculation Formula

Hours = Frame Count ÷ (FPS × 3600)
Minutes = Remaining Frames ÷ (FPS × 60)
Seconds = Remaining Frames ÷ FPS
Frames = Frame Count % FPS

Example:

240 frames @ 24fps = 00:00:10:00 (0 hours, 0 minutes, 10 seconds, 0 frames)
